The Land Rover Discovery Sport P270e PHEV Landmark is a suv powered by an plug-in hybrid drivetrain delivering 160 hp (118 kW). It acc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 7.4 s and reaches a top speed of 190 km/h. The P270e PHEV Landmark offers a range of 60 km, a battery capacity of 12.2 kWh, energy consumption of 4.0 kWh/100 km. Drive is routed to the all-wheel-drive axle via an automatic. This variant was introduced in 2025 as part of the Land Rover Discovery Sport (2023-) generation, and sits alongside 3 other variants in this generation.
